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4790 30925774700 68422
62 51 0802244
62 51 0802244
8749424451 6962 42535657695 17928 0185413
All about undefined
Interested in learning more?
62 51 0802244
8749424451 6962 42535657695 17928 0185413
See more
5631403527 697177 76
767604701 9142 15243381
See more
7536548 383110 3035
267 259 01 8221760
See more